Why Sirloin Steak Is a Must-Try
Sirloin steak comes from the muscular center of the cow’s back, making it leaner than premium cuts like ribeye but still packed with rich, beefy flavor. With variations such as strip loin or tenderloin-style sirloin, this cut delivers a satisfying chew and a sculpted texture ideal for quick cooking methods. Perfectly seared or slow-cooked, sirloin adapts beautifully to countless seasonings—from classic seasoning blends to bold, global inspirations.
How to Cook the Perfect Sirloin Steak: Essential Techniques
Key Insights
Before diving into recipes, mastering a couple of key cooking techniques ensures success:
- Proper Seasoning: A dry rub or high-quality seasoning enhances flavor penetration. Think garlic, herbs, ginger, salt, pepper, and a touch of sugar.
- Controlled Heat: High heat sears the surface for a flavorful crust while keeping the interior tender. Finish with a lower temperature if needed for medium doneness.
- Rest Time: Let the steak rest for 5–10 minutes post-cooking to redistribute juices for maximum tenderness.

2. Korean BBQ Style Marinated Sirloin
Ideal for: Bold, spicy flavors and addictive flavor depth
Ingredients:
- 1.5 lb sirloin, thinly sliced against the grain
- ½ cup soy sauce
- ¼ cup sesame oil
- 3 tbsp brown sugar (or maple syrup)
- 4 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 tbsp rice wine or mirin
- 1 tsp sesame seeds (for garnish)
Method:
- Whisk all marinade ingredients and toss sliced sirloin in marinade for at least 1 hour (overnight is best).
- Preheat grill or cast-iron skillet over medium-high heat.
- Grill slices in crosshatch patterns for 4–5 minutes per side until charred with crispy edges.
- Drizzle with extra marinade and serve with kimchi rice, pickled radishes, and garlic drizzle.
